Note:
Whenever using the substitution method to find out the integral of an expression, we should always be careful as to what to substitute in the place of our original variable. The substitute should be such that it reduces the complexity in our equation. This makes our new equation easy to understand and solve. The new equation sometimes might even become a standard integral just like in this case.
